Company Description

PubMatic delivers superior revenue to publishers by being the sell-side platform of choice for agencies and advertisers. 

The PubMatic platform empowers independent app developers and publishers to maximize their digital advertising monetization while enabling advertisers to increase ROI by reaching and engaging their target audiences in brand-safe, premium environments across ad formats and devices. 

Since 2006, PubMatic has created an efficient, global infrastructure and remains at the forefront of programmatic innovation. Headquartered in Redwood City, California, PubMatic operates 14 offices and nine data centers worldwide.

Job Description

We are immediately hiring a Marketplace Manager to join our growing programmatic team in Redwood City

The Marketplace Manager is an analytical, business-facing role, optimizing auction dynamics across channels. This key contributor drives outcomes for the publisher's perspective on yield management (fill rate, price, revenue), as well as the advertiser's return on their spend (click-through rates, conversions, pricing and win rate).

Working with clients and Customer Success teams, the Marketplace Manager builds optimizing strategies for delivery, scaling from the individual account level to global. Partnered with Product and Engineering, the Marketplace Manager also helps build new marketplace capabilities - setting requirements, defining success, and helping to implement new solutions.

The Marketplace Manager drives communication across stakeholders, often working directly with client executives and PubMatic senior leadership. The successful candidate will exhibit business acumen, technical understanding and the consultative skills required to present recommendations across a range of audiences – all the way to the C-suite.
